About Schools in Buffalo Grove, Illinois
Buffalo Grove, Illinois is home to 17 schools, including 12 public schools and 5 private schools. The city's schools span 13 elementary schools, 3 middle schools, and 1 high school.
With an average rating of 7.1 out of 10, schools in Buffalo Grove perform strongly on the MySchoolScout composite scale, which measures academic achievement, student growth, equity, and school environment.
The highest-performing school in Buffalo Grove is Cooper Middle School with a composite score of 8.5/10, demonstrating strong academic outcomes and school quality metrics.
Buffalo Grove is served by 4 school districts. These districts collectively serve 24,363 students.
Buffalo Grove's community shows 67% bachelor's degree attainment with a median household income of $129,932. The poverty rate in the area is 6.5%.

Community Profile
Buffalo Grove has a median household income of $129,932. It is a well-educated community where 67%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$393,000, with a median rent of $2,042/month. The local poverty rate of 6.5% is relatively low. The average commute for residents is 28 minutes.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.

How We Rate Schools
Every school receives a composite score from 1 to 10 based on four pillars: Academic Performance (50%), Student Growth (20%), Equity (15%), and Learning Environment (15%). Scores are built from publicly available data including standardized test results, enrollment figures, and school climate indicators.

How many school districts serve Buffalo Grove, Illinois?
Buffalo Grove is served by 4 school districts: Aptakisic-tripp Ccsd 102, Township Hsd 214, Kildeer Countryside Ccsd 96, Wheeling Ccsd 21.
